You want to know who determines need? First, the guy in charge of the research program writes up a nice long grant proposal. The proposal goes on to a board who reads it and decides, "Is this reasonable? Is it interesting? Is it profitable? It it significant?" They assign it a certain rating depending on how those questions are answered. The grant proposals that score highly are awarded grants, and the ones that fail are not.

I'm currently waiting to find out whether our research group is going to receive a $100,000/year addition to our NIH grant of a couple million. If so, we'll build a cell culture facility so that I can test the efficacy of several drug partial structures against various strains of cancer cells.

Drug companies bring drugs to the market after spending an average of $500 million to $1 billion on research and development. They do most of their research in analogues of lead compounds, and some identification of lead compounds, but many of the lead compounds that end up bringing a drug to the market that might save hundreds of thousands of lives were discovered by a university research group receiving a federal grant of a million or less a year.
